Junior High girls continue winning ways

The Oran Junior High School girls basketball teams picked up two more wins last night, defeating visiting conference foe East Prairie 36-21 in the seventh-grade game and 46-16 in the eighth-grade contest.

Coach Ethan Evans said, "The seventh-grade game was sloppy, especially the 1st half. Fortunately, we played good enough defense to have the lead. We played much better in the 3rd quarter to pull out the victory."

Addie Nichols scored 12 to lead the team that is now 3-0 in both the conference and overall.

Grace Davis added eight, Hallie Nichols added five while Bralynn Morgan chipped in four. Laney Shy, Emma Priggel and Maddie Stickel each had a field goal.

The team was 2 of 5 from the line for 40%.

Coach Evans commented that the eight-grade, "Played very well both offensively and defensively. We got after them in the press and got some easy baskets. Overall it was the best game the girls have played all year."

Hope Woodfin led the older team with 18 points, Davis was right behind with 16.

Rylee Boshell added seven, Priggel had four and Hallie Nichols made a free throw.

The team made seven of 18 free throws for 39%.

They are now 4-0 in the Scott-Miss and 5-0 in all games.

The Eagles will be back in action this evening at 6 pm when they host the Woodland Cardinals.
